✨JSON.stringify用法💡
在日常开发中,`JSON.stringify` 是一个非常实用的工具,它能将 JavaScript 对象或值转换为 JSON 字符串。这不仅便于数据存储和传输,还能帮助我们更好地理解对象结构。那么,如何正确使用它呢?👇
首先,让我们看看基本语法:
```javascript
JSON.stringify(value, replacer?, space?)
```
- `value`:需要转换的对象或值。
- `replacer`(可选):用于修改输出结果。
- `space`(可选):指定缩进格式,让输出更易读。
例如:
```javascript
const obj = { name: "Alice", age: 25 };
console.log(JSON.stringify(obj));
// 输出: {"name":"Alice","age":25}
```
如果想让输出更有层次感,可以加入缩进:
```javascript
console.log(JSON.stringify(obj, null, 2));
// 输出:
// {
// "name": "Alice",
// "age": 25
// }
```
此外,`replacer` 参数还可以自定义规则,比如过滤某些字段:
```javascript
const filteredObj = JSON.stringify(obj, ['name']);
console.log(filteredObj);
// 输出: {"name":"Alice"}
```
总之,`JSON.stringify` 是前端开发中的得力助手,灵活运用能让代码更高效!🌟
免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。